BCG Matrix
A strategic planning tool that uses graphical representations of a company’s products and services to help management decide where to invest, develop, or discontinue.
Cash Cow
A cash cow is a business term for a product or business segment that generates consistently high profit margins and significant cash flow, with minimal investment.
Break-Even Analysis
An evaluation to determine the point at which revenue received equals the costs associated with receiving the revenue, indicating no net loss or gain.
